Archibald, being a smaller community, may not have the same variety of internet options as larger cities. Common types of internet connections available include satellite, fixed wireless, and potentially DSL. The availability and performance of each type can vary depending on your specific location within Archibald. Understanding the pros and cons of each technology is crucial for choosing the right provider.
Finding the most affordable internet plan is a priority for many households. While prices are subject to change and promotional offers can vary, satellite internet providers like Viasat and HughesNet often offer some of the most budget-friendly options in areas with limited wired infrastructure. However, it's important to consider the data caps and potential overage charges associated with these plans. Remember to factor in installation fees and equipment costs when comparing the overall cost.
Provider | Starting Price | Download Speed (Up to) | Data Cap | Notes |
---|---|---|---|---|
Viasat | $49.99/month | 25 Mbps | 40 GB | Prices and speeds may vary based on location and plan availability. Additional fees may apply. |
HughesNet | $49.99/month | 25 Mbps | 30 GB | Prices and speeds may vary based on location and plan availability. Additional fees may apply. |
If speed is your primary concern, the options in Archibald might be limited compared to larger metropolitan areas. Satellite internet often has capped speeds. Fixed Wireless could offer better speeds, but it is very dependent on location and availability. Always check with local providers to confirm actual speeds in your area of Archibald, LA.
Provider | Download Speed (Up to) | Upload Speed (Up to) | Technology | Notes |
---|---|---|---|---|
Viasat | 100 Mbps | 3 Mbps | Satellite | Speeds are "up to" and dependent on plan. Performance can vary. |
HughesNet | 50 Mbps | 5 Mbps | Satellite | Speeds are "up to" and dependent on plan. Performance can vary. |

Residential internet coverage in Archibald is primarily served by satellite providers such as Viasat and HughesNet. These providers offer near-universal coverage, making them a viable option for residents throughout the community. The availability of other types of internet connections, such as fixed wireless, can be more limited and dependent on specific location. Checking availability directly with providers using your address is recommended to determine the best options at your residence.

Latency refers to the delay in data transmission. High latency can negatively impact online gaming, video conferencing, and other real-time applications. Satellite internet typically has higher latency than other types of connections.
